In order to minimize the volume within the shell, a
central tubular insert may be provided which falls
within the helical coil. This is particularly useful in
refrigeration systems and heat pumps so that the quan
tity of refrigerant may be minimized. Example of a shell 35
and coil heat exchanger having an inner shell to mini
mize shell cavity volume is shown in U.S. Pat. No.
2,668,692 and companion U.S. Pat. No. 2,668,420. In
spite of the inner shell, a significant disadvantage of the
shell heat exchangers are the large volume of the shell
cavity relative to the volume of the liquid within the
coiled tubing.
